是否有一个很好的快速入门指南,用于使用Sandcastle生成API文档?

时间:2009-08-04 18:33:51

标签: c# documentation-generation sandcastle

我将使用Sandcastle生成API文档 - 我找不到任何有关如何在该网站上执行此操作的指南。有没有人有他们推荐的快速入门指南?

3 个答案:

答案 0 :(得分:8)

我建议使用SHFB(如果可以的话),因为它使它变得更容易。 SHFB附带文档,但您可以在没有任何教程的情况下使用它的常用功能。

答案 1 :(得分:2)

我也是SHFB的强烈支持,以至于在2010年9月我写了一篇关于Sandcastle和SHFB的文章,标题为Taming Sandcastle: A .NET Programmer's Guide to Documenting Your Code,其中我描述了使用技巧和许多潜在的陷阱一个人很可能会遇到。 2010年10月,我用one-page wall chart跟进了它,总结了SHFB的XML文档评论词典。

根据我对该文章的研究,以下是其他有用资源的完整列表:

答案 2 :(得分:0)

也许您可以查看SandCastle的(codeplex)网站。但我的经验是,最好只是玩它。首先要做的是配置应用程序以将注释生成为XML文件(并在代码中使用XML注释)。这是项目中的一个设置。

接下来你可以做的是将带有相关XML的程序集加载到Sandcastle中并使用设置(在大多数情况下,默认设置足够好)。大多数设置都是自我记录的,或者通过查看名称来显而易见。

祝你好运!